During the eight-day tour, Maryam will be accompanied by a delegation. The major cities included in the itinerary are Beijing, Shanghai, and Guangdong.
This invitation is meant to strengthen the bond between the ruling party of China and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) and develop strong connections between the two countries.

This visit is based on collaborative efforts in areas like information technology, healthcare, industry, smog management, and changes due to climate. The talks will also focus on improving the business and trade ties between Punjab and China.
Maryam Nawaz would be apprised of the development model and governance system of China while meeting senior leaders and officials of China about bilateral cooperation.
